Least Common Multiple of 56415 and 56433 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 56415 and 56433, than apply into the LCM equation.

GCF(56415,56433) = 3
LCM(56415,56433) = ( 56415 × 56433) / 3
LCM(56415,56433) = 3183667695 / 3
LCM(56415,56433) = 1061222565
